Responsibilities

  • Take food and beverage orders and place orders in point of service system.
  • Ensure overall guest satisfaction.
  • Set and clear tables in dining areas.
  • Stock service stations with items such as ice, napkins, or straws.
  • Pick up order from food preparation areas and ensure food is prepared accordingly.
  • Delivers food, beverages, condiments, and other requested items
  • Ensure that food is prepared correctly and to the guest’s satisfaction; return incorrect or improperly cooked items to the kitchen
  • Collect plates and clear table as guests finish their meal
  • Prepare guest check and if appropriate complete payment transaction.
  • Perform other food and beverage functions such as bartending and bussing in the event of staff staffing shortages or peak periods.
  • Prepare workstation for readiness prior to opening and closing of each shift.
  • Follow all cash handling and bank operating procedures
  • Perform all side work duties according to side work schedules.
  • While interacting with guests inform them of enhancements to their dining experience.
  • Be aware of guest satisfaction scores and work toward increasing departmental and overall guest satisfaction.
  • Practice safe work habits, wear protective safety equipment and follow MSDS and OSHA standards.
  • Perform other duties as requested by management.
